HOWLIN PLEDGES LABOUR SUPPORT TO SDLP IN ASSEMBLY ELECTIONS

16 January 2017

Labour leader Brendan Howlin has today pledged the support of the Labour Party to our colleagues in the SDLP, as they begin an election campaign that will conclude on March 2nd.

“Over recent weeks, we have seen a scandal caused by the DUP bring Stormont to a shuddering halt. Sinn Féin, who were initially happy to stand back and let the rot fester, belatedly realised that Colum Eastwood was right to call for public accountabiity into a scandalous misuse of taxpayers’s money.

“Having brought the Assembly down, Sinn Féin are now effectively arguing for the reelection of the same Government that caused the mess. Too many commentators are arguing that this election can’t change any of the issues that brought us to this point. But in reality, the only thing that could achieve such change is the election of a different Government.

“In contrast, the SDLP has shown a willingness to reach across the aisle, and a genuine ability to begin to construct a coherent opposition in Stormont for the first time.

“Over recent months, Colum and I have been working together within the Party of European Socialists, to argue for a Brexit outcome that will protect all of the people of this island. Along with my parliamentary party colleagues, I look forward to standing on doorsteps with him over the coming weeks to ask people to give the SDLP a mandate to deepen that work, and to turn away from the tawdry politics that brought us here.”
